基于SIP协议IP语音软终端的设计与实现的任务书.docxVIP

  • 2
  • 0
  • 约小于1千字
  • 约 2页
  • 2024-03-16 发布于上海
  • 举报

基于SIP协议IP语音软终端的设计与实现的任务书.docx

基于SIP协议IP语音软终端的设计与实现的任务书

一、任务背景

随着IP电话技术的发展,越来越多的企事业单位正在转向IP电话系统。采用基于SIP协议的IP电话,可将语音、视频、IM等多种应用集成在一个通话系统中,实现语音电话、视频电话、会议等功能。为满足用户对IP电话的需求,需要开发一种基于SIP协议的IP语音软终端,实现与各种IP电话系统的兼容性,并提供可靠、高质量的语音通信服务。

二、任务目标

本次任务的目标是设计并实现一个基于SIP协议的IP语音软终端。具体包括以下几个方面:

1.实现与各种IP电话系统的兼容性,包括与SIP服务器的交互、与其他终端的通信等。

2.支持语音呼叫、视频通话、会议等多种功能。

3.实现高质量、可靠的语音通信服务,同时保证服务的实时性和稳定性。

4.支持多种编解码格式,并能适应不同网络环境下的流量控制和带宽管理。

三、任务内容

本次任务的主要内容包括以下几个方面:

1.SIP协议的研究和实现,包括方法、状态、报文格式、SIP消息交互等。

2.设计并实现基于SIP协议的IP语音软终端,包括界面设计、会议控制、呼叫管理、媒体传输、RTP协议等方面的处理。

3.测试验证软终端的功能、性能和稳定性,并对其进行调试和优化,使其能够满足用户量大、呼叫质量高、接入层次低等需求。

4.文档编写,包括需求规格说明书、概要设计说明书、详细设计说明书、用户手册等。

四、任务要求

1.熟练掌握计算机网络原理,了解SIP协议的过程和机制。

2.掌握音频编解码算法,了解音频质量测评和网络传输的影响,熟悉RTP协议。

3.具有C/C++编程能力,熟悉Qt编程框架,理解MVC模式和面向对象程序设计思想。

4.具备较强的团队协作能力和沟通能力,能够快速地学习和适应新技术。

五、参考文献

1.《SIP协议原理与实践》王颖章,电子工业出版社。

2.《计算机网络:自顶向下方法》JamesF.KuroseandKeithW.Ross,机械工业出版社。

3.《音频和视频传输的技术和标准》曹志强等,电子工业出版社。

4.《C++程序设计》荣彩和,机械工业出版社。

5.《Qt5开发指南》姜文,人民邮电出版社。

文档评论(0)

1亿VIP精品文档

相关文档